  18. ... the dust from your PC. Just a friendly reminder to everyone to check your PC’s (Personal Computer’s) for internal dust, especially around the cooling fans and power supply. I took my unit outside today, opened it up and took the air hose to it now it’s as clean as a whistle! Yes I know, it's hard to unplug from VentureRider.org but it will only take you a moment. Besides, if it hasn’t been done in a while it might just save yourself power supply problems down the road. If you don’t have a compressor with ‘dry air’ you can buy compressed air in a spray can. Don’t forget to unplug!
